I’m convinced that the Dutch legal system is better then the American system.
It use to be the other way around, and there are flaws in both, but given the choice, I’m not in favour of contradicting experts and credibility of the experts. (In Holland, all experts are considered to be credible and when two experts contradict, the judge appoints an independent expert who’s results will be considered to be the most valued.)
Also I don’t agree with the Jury system cause a judge can ignore leading questions or remarks which push the line, and ‘normal’ people don’t understand laws or the workings of them
So in America it’s basically a contest of who has the better lawyer then the actual truth.
